A 16-year-old boy with chronic granulomatous disease presented with pneumonia and rib osteomyelitis. Emericella nidulans var. echinulata was isolated from his sputum. After starting voriconazole, Rasamsonia piperina was isolated from the rib swelling. A combination therapy of voriconazole and micafungin effectively eradicated this invasive mixed-mold infection. In immunocompromised patients, a precise pathogenic diagnosis is clinically useful for administration of an appropriate treatment regimen.

To our knowledge, this is the first report of the use of real-time reverse transcription–polymerase chain reaction to assess changes in viral load in a patient with congenital rubella syndrome (CRS). Rubella-specific antibody titers were also determined. The patient was a male neonate born to a primipara with rubella infection at 10 weeks of gestation. He had no symptoms at birth, but rubella virus was detected in his pharynx, blood, and urine. His mental and physical development was normal for 1 year; however, he was diagnosed with deafness at 13 months of age. Thus, the patient was diagnosed with CRS. Rubella infection in the pharynx was almost constant until 5 months of age; however, it increased dramatically at 6 months of age. No infection was detected at 13 months. Rubella-specific immunoglobulin M titer was consistently low until 9 months of age and then decreased gradually until it became negative at 20 months of age. Rubella-specific immunoglobulin G titer was high at birth. However, it decreased at 3 months and increased again at 4 months. This titer peaked at ∼9 months and then decreased again at 13 months. This case shows that the period after the decline in maternal antibody titers, not the neonatal period, may be the most contagious period in patients with CRS.

We report a case of mediastinal subcutaneous and multiple muscular abscesses caused by group B streptococcus serotype VIII in a type 2 diabetes mellitus patient. The patient arrived at the hospital with the chief complaint of immobility, and blood examination results suggested an acute infection and poorly controlled diabetes mellitus. Group B streptococcal bacteria were cultured from the patients blood, and identified as serotype VIII upon further analysis. The patient recovered without any sequelae after percutaneous drainage, antibiotic therapy, and intensive glycemic control. Although the incidence of group B streptococcal infection in non-pregnant adults has recently increased in many developed countries, information on serotype VIII infection is quite limited. The reason is that serotype VIII group B streptococci are a Japan-specific serotype, and rarely cause invasive infections, even in Japan. Therefore, further surveillance and case reports should be documented in the future.
